The Role
The Support Specialist is the person our customers hear from when they have a question, hit a snag, or need help. VenueSumo operates across the US, Australia, UK, and Canada — this role provides support coverage across all regions. Weekend availability is a core part of the schedule (both weekend days required, any 3 weekdays of your choice — preferred hours 7:00 AM–4:00 PM MT).
This is a dedicated support role focused on resolution, responsiveness, and technical excellence — not account management. You'll have a short line to our product and development team, and your frontline insights will directly shape how VenueSumo improves.
Key Responsibilities
- Manage inbound support tickets and emails from clients across the US, Australia, UK, and Canada
- Handle inbound support calls — providing clear, calm guidance and real-time troubleshooting
- Diagnose and investigate technical issues across the platform (hardware, software, integrations, payments)
- Log and document bugs and recurring issues in Jira with clear, detailed write-ups
- Contribute to internal knowledge bases and support documentation
- Surface patterns and insights from support requests to leadership and the product team
